Output 84ba9c96a0b2b9df6e775fdc3fd88a6a0c1cc87dd15dcda344a89252da2be18e:2

value
34295332
script pubkey
OP_0 OP_PUSHBYTES_32 d6951494e5361c8e2f30c0f0109ecd5af44aa2c2f52ced451aaf32e204b0fc1a
address
bc1q6623f989xcwgutescrcpp8kdtt6y4gkz75kw63g64uewyp9slsdquu0744
transaction
84ba9c96a0b2b9df6e775fdc3fd88a6a0c1cc87dd15dcda344a89252da2be18e
confirmations
152435
spent
true